Star Wars Figure of the Day: Day 2,392: Imperial Royal Guard (The Black Series)

By Adam Pawlus — Wednesday, August 2, 2017

Today: let's look at the not-common-enough Imperial Royal Guard (The Black Series) 6-inch action figure!  It's really cool - and the helmet isn't removable.  You do get armor under the robes, so custom Kir Kanos figures can't be far behind.   Read on!

35 More Kmart, 8 Sears Closures

By Adam Pawlus — Friday, July 7, 2017

Formerly two of the biggest juggernauts in America, it seems like we're having regular monthly updates on more store closures for both Kmart and Sears.  In a blog at Sears Holdings, 35 more Kmarts and 8 more Searses are set to begin liquidation this week - including the last remotely handy Kmart to GHHQ.
